U.S. Life Insurance Activity Reverses in July Reports the MIB Life Index
August 14, 2019 by MIB Life Index
Braintree, MA. (August 8, 2019) — U.S. life insurance application activity reversed direction in July displacing virtually all of the prior June’s gains, down -3.2% Y/Y, according to the MIB Life Index. The 2019 MIB Life Index reflects a zigzag pattern that included five months of small gains peppered by two months of sharp declines, keeping the Life Index consistently hovering near par at -0.3% YTD. July’s application activity was down -7.8% from that of June, sharply steeper than typical July summer declines.
Older age life insurance buyers have outpaced all Life Index age groups posting Y/Y gains in every month since May 2018. In July, application activity ages 0-44 was off -6.9%, ages 45-59 was off -3.4%, and ages 60+ was up 7.2% Y/Y. On a YTD basis, all ages groups lost ground from last month with application activity ages 0-44 off -4.9%; ages 45-59 remaining positive for the year, up 0.5%; and ages 60+ down slightly at 12% YTD July.
